This is a thoroughly immersive experience which takes you into the daily life of Langa, the oldest township in South Africa. Your local guide, Sugar, will take you on a walking tour to reveal the rich history of the township, its connection to Apartheid, and its current uplifting initiatives. Your first stop will bring you face to face with uniquely talented local Langa artists. You will take local transportation, visit a spaza shop, observe what the local Langa women barbeque (braai). You will be invited into a Langa family home where you will enjoy a light African meal together. This is an opportunity to gain insights into how most South Africans live and support local communities.
